One thing I always do, no matter what MF Nikon I'm shooting, is to rotate the takeup spool by hand until the leader has wrapped around the spool once. Then, I close the back and fire my two shots, leaving the camera uncocked when I'm done. That is, unless I'm loading in the field and will be shooting immediately after I load the camera up.
